    This is a vendor review submitted by IamtheDave on PeptideCritic.com.

    Rating: ⭐⭐ (2/5)


    Review

    My first peptide purchase ever was from Elite Biogenix and it was GLP3. I also bought GLP3 from another vendor the next day. I actually haven't started using the peptide from Elite BioGenix yet as the other order looked more professional. What I mean by that is the label on the vial looks like it was just taped on with scotch tape. It's impossible to read, and the QR code is so fuzzy that it's unscannable. This makes me not trust this company, HOWEVER - I did get it 3rd party tested for purity and Endotoxin. The purity came back at 99.6%. The endotoxin came back at 35.6 EU/vial (40 EU/vial is the limit for passing the test). While it's a passing score, it is one of the highest endotoxin results I've seen out there. I'm giving 2 stars due to actually being sold GLP3, but for the insane price of nearly $200/10mg vial...literally the most expensive on the market, I expect better labels and quality.
